Bigelow's beggarticks
Bidens bigelovii

Family: Asteraceae


What it is like

A herb. It keeps growing from year to year. The leaves are thin. The leaves are divided 3 or more times.

There are about 200 Bidens species. Most are in North America.


Where it is found

It is a temperate plant.

Countries/locations it is found in

Mexico, North America, USA


How it is used for food

The flowers are used for tea.

Edible parts

Flowers - tea
